Ipad Robber Gets 15 Years

A 19-year-old driver, Abdul Rashid Zuberu, has been sentenced to 15 years’ imprisonment in hard labour by an Accra Circuit Court for robbing a woman of her Ipad at knifepoint.

The convict attacked one Mamame Esi Abbam, a human resource manager, with a kitchen knife and made away with the Ipad valued at GH¢350.00

Zuberu, who is also a labourer, was hauled before the court on the charge of robbery.

He pleaded guilty to the charge.

He was subsequently convicted on his own plea by the court, presided over by Aboagye Tandoh.

The court considered his guilty plea and the fact that he was a first-time offender.

The prosecution told the court that the convict, who worked in the complainant’s house on May 5, 2018, stormed the house with his two friends, who were wielding kitchen knife and cutlass.

The court heard that the convict and his accomplice threatened the victim in the house and took the Ipad afterwards.

He later admitted the offence in his caution statement during police interrogations.
